Composer's note: "'Pentecost' for solo piano is built around the Gospel Acclamation chant for the Feast of Pentecost. The work is in three short movements each based on its own section of the chant. The opening of the work – Alleluia.Veni Sancte Spiritus (Alleluia. Come Holy Spirit) – strips the first segment of plainchant down to its bare bones in a bold and dramatic series of glissandi which eventually lead into a procession of rich harmonies before a climax is followed by a quiet coda. The middle movement – repletuorum corda fidelium (fill the hearts of your faithful) – begins with light fragments of melody, disjointed and distant-sounding, before building to a warm and sustained middle section with music that continually moves forward filling the space. Movement 3 – et tui amoris in eis ignem accende. Alleluia. (and kindle in them the fire of your love. Alleluia.) – brings together many different motifs, some already heard, in a fiery, dramatic outburst which subsides into a lyrical and gentle coda. Throughout the work the chant is never obvious; sometimes it is buried deep in a series of low grace-notes as in the first movement, sometimes it is telescoped to serve as 'bells' in the middle movement, or forms a warm thread in the harmonies of the thoughtful final section of the work. The work is dedicated to Matthew Schellhorn who, when asking me to write a solo piano work, suggested it was based around a piece of the ancient liturgical chant of the Church."
